    Re: How can I view my collection via tag?

    From "your collection" you will be able to add tags in your books. If you are having one of the options within the drop down filter list is as 'view' by tags then you click on the tag for the books you desire to see. I have tagged a few books but not all so I don't use that but I just tried it and it's not working for me either. Therefore I would say that it is an issue at Amazon and this is not only you who is facing this. I am also in that list and waiting for it to be resolved.
